On Wed, Oct 31, 2007 at 10:55:01PM +0100, Sam Ravnborg wrote:
> It has been requested that we should let x86 behave like
> other architectures so we at config time decide for 32 or 64 bit.
> The challenge here is to mere the Kconfig files and I have done
> an attempt to do so.
Just a heads up...
I have started to redo the patch below in smaller chunks and expect
to finish this tomorrow.
The cpufreq Kconfig file is done so no need for help here.
I hope to make the patches small enough so we can be confident to
apply them despite that we are heading -rc2.
It would be nice to get "make ARCH=x86" working before next
kernel release - and with the Kconfig files merged this is trivial.
I hope the x86 maintainers agree - but that yours decision.
